[quote=Anonymous]In my best relationships with my closest friends, we both try to push our own boundaries to make the other person happy, and we both strive to respect the other person’s boundaries. For example, I would never call a SAHM friend around school drop off time because I know she is busy, but if I needed to, I know she would answer. She didn’t have to tell me that or set some kind of boundary. I think these are harder in a marriage. There are a lot of gender dynamics at play and there is a lot of fluidity and confusion about what roles both partners should have. [/quote]
